HTC Salsa officially launched in India @ Rs.22000

htc salsa

The HTC Salsa which is an Android phone with Facebook functionality has been officially launched it India after it started selling online. The  handset has been launched at a Market Operating Price of Rs.22000 and is available for as low as Rs.20500 online. If you are really addicted to Facebook , you can check out the Salsa or wait for the ChaCha with comes with a QWERTY keyboard.

Motorola Unveils The Android Powered Motorola Triumph

Motorola recently announced a new Android powered Motorola Triumph smartphone. This handset runs on the old Android 2.2 (Froyo) Operating System and it will be available exclusively to Virgin Mobile customers in the US.

The Motorola Triumph comes with a 4.1 inch WVGA display, 1 GHz processor, 5 megapixel camera with HD (720p) video recording, 32 GB expandable memory and more. Motorola Triumph is the first handset to come preloaded with the Virgin Mobile Live 2.0 app used to access the Virgin Mobile branded music stream. Motorola And Sprint Announces The Motorola Photon 4G

Motorola recently announced a new Android powered smartphone, the Motorola Photon 4G. This handset is the company’s first Sprint 4G device with dual-core processor and Android 2.3 OS.

Motorola and Sprint recently announced a new Android powered smartphone, the Motorola Photon 4G at an event in the New York City. The Motorola Photon 4G is the company’s first Sprint 4G device with a 1 GHz dual-core NVIDIA Tegra 2 processor and Android 2.3 (Gingerbread) Operating System. This handset comes with a 4.3 inch qHD display, 8 megapixel camera with dual-LED flash, 16 GB internal memory and a kickstand for hands-free viewing.
